Boosting Your UK WooCommerce Store with Targeted SEO
To successfully dominate the UK e-commerce landscape, your WooCommerce store needs a powerful SEO strategy uniquely for the British market. This means going beyond basic SEO practices and adopting techniques that appeal with UK consumers and search engines.
One vital aspect is enhancing your product pages for location-based keywords. Think copyright like "buy [product] in London" or "best [product] UK". This signals to search engines that your store is a reliable source for customers in the UK.
- Moreover, ensure your website structure is user-friendly and mobile-responsive, as this makes a significant role in search engine rankings.
- Don't dismiss the power of local citations. Registering your business to relevant UK directories can boost your local SEO and reach among potential customers.
Finally, by adopting these UK-specific WooCommerce SEO strategies, you can increase your store's visibility in search results and gain more valuable customers from the UK market.
Elevate Your WooCommerce SEO in the UK Market
Unlock the power of search engine optimization (SEO) to skyrocket your WooCommerce store's visibility and pull more customers in the vibrant UK market. This comprehensive guide unveils the essential strategies and tools you need to conquer the digital landscape.
From optimizing your product pages to mastering keyword research, we'll equip you with the knowledge to climb to the top of search results and beat your competition. Prepare to harness the full potential of SEO and watch your WooCommerce store thrive in the UK market.
Here are some key areas to concentrate:
* **Keyword Research:** Identify the most relevant phrases that your target audience is using
* **On-Page Optimization:** Fine-tune your product titles, descriptions, and content to integrate your target keywords effectively.
* **Technical SEO:** Ensure your store's technical infrastructure is optimized for search engines, including site speed, mobile responsiveness, and XML sitemaps.
* **Off-Page SEO:** Build valuable backlinks from reputable websites to amplify your store's authority and credibility in the eyes of search engines.
By diligently implementing these strategies, you can gain a strong SEO foundation for your WooCommerce store in the UK market.
